Termite damage in Calvin is not a slow problem — it's a silent one. Subterranean termite colonies active in Winn County soil can consume structural wood at a rate that produces meaningful damage before any surface sign appears. The mud tubes, the soft spots in framing, the hollow-sounding wood — these are late indicators, not early ones. An inspection while no sign is visible is the only reliable way to catch termite activity before it reaches the stage where the cost is measured in structural repairs.

Calvin pest activity follows a predictable calendar that Winn County homeowners can plan around. Termite swarm season typically begins in late March when soil temperatures reach threshold, peaking through May. Mosquito populations build from late April through August. Rodents begin active structural entry in October as outdoor temperatures drop. Carpenter bee activity in Calvin may appear superficially harmless — the bees are large but generally non-aggressive, and the initial holes they bore are small. But carpenter bee galleries in Winn County homes extend horizontally inside the wood, creating a network of tunnels that weakens the structural member and attracts woodpeckers that dramatically expand the damage. Fascia boards, deck rails, window trim, and exposed rafters are common targets. What a Pest Inspection Covers in Calvin

Bed bug inspections in Calvin follow a room-by-room protocol covering mattress seams, box spring fabric, headboard joints, nightstand drawers, baseboards, and electrical outlet covers — the harborage areas where populations establish and spread. Because bed bug infestations in Winn County are not confined to one room by the time most homeowners identify them, the inspection covers all sleeping and resting areas to map the full extent of the infestation. That scope determines whether the treatment approach is heat, chemical, or a combination — and the coverage area required.
